企业包厢管理方案模板
模板大师
阅读:-
2023-10-09 03:32:47
企业包厢管理方案模板
一、摘要
本文旨在提出一种企业包厢管理方案模板,以提高包厢服务质量,实现包厢预订、消费明细记录等功能。本文将结合企业实际情况,从需求分析、系统设计、系统实现和系统维护等方面进行论述。
二、需求分析
1.用户需求
(1) 用户可以通过网站或APP进行包厢预订,选择包厢类型、数量、价格等。
(2) 用户可以查看包厢实时预订情况,以及历史预订记录。
(3) 用户可以进行消费,记录消费明细,包括消费金额、消费时间等。
(4) 用户可以查看当前包厢消费记录,生成对账单。
(5) 用户可以对包厢及消费进行评价。
2. 商家需求
(1) 商家可以添加、编辑、删除包厢信息。
(2) 商家可以查看包厢预订情况,以及历史预订记录。
(3) 商家可以进行消费记录查询、修改、删除。
(4) 商家可以生成对账单。
三、系统设计
1.技术选型
(1) 前端:HTML、CSS、JavaScript、Vue.js
(2) 后端:Java、Spring Boot、MyBatis、MySQL
2. 系统架构设计
(1) 系统采用前后端分离架构。
(2) 前端使用Vue.js,实现用户界面;后端使用MyBatis实现数据交互,通过接口调用MySQL数据库存储数据。
(3) 系统采用Restful API设计,实现多终端访问。
3. 数据库设计
(1) 用户表:包括用户ID、用户名、密码、电话、邮箱等。
(2) 包厢表:包括包厢ID、包厢名称、包厢类型、价格等。
(3) 消费表:包括消费ID、消费明细、消费时间、消费金额等。
(4) 商家表:包括商家ID、商家名称、联系方式等。
(5) 对账单表:包括对账单ID、对账单时间、对账单内容等。
四、系统实现
1.前端开发
(1) 使用Vue-cli创建项目,安装依赖。
(2) 使用Vue的单文件组件实现用户界面。
(3) 使用Vue的axios库调用后端接口,获取数据并展示。
(4) 使用Vue的life-event组件实现用户交互功能,如搜索、排序等。
2. 后端开发
(1) 使用MyBatis实现数据层的搭建。
(2) 使用Spring Boot实现业务逻辑的实现。
(3) 使用MySQL存储数据,并设计合理的索引。
(4) 对接 payment 支付接口,实现支付功能。
3. 系统部署与测试
(1) 使用Docker部署系统,发布到服务器。
(2) 使用Postman等工具进行测试,确保系统功能正常。 五、系统维护
1.升级系统:根据实际需求,对系统进行升级,增强系统功能。
2. 数据备份:定期对系统数据进行备份,防止数据丢失。
3. 安全性维护:对用户密码等敏感信息进行加密处理,提高系统安全性。
4. 性能优化:对系统性能进行优化,提高系统运行速度。
上一篇: 登山徒步组团方案模板
下一篇: 侨联项目方案范文模板 1.用户需求
(1) 用户可以通过网站或APP进行包厢预订,选择包厢类型、数量、价格等。
(2) 用户可以查看包厢实时预订情况,以及历史预订记录。
(3) 用户可以进行消费,记录消费明细,包括消费金额、消费时间等。
(4) 用户可以查看当前包厢消费记录,生成对账单。
(5) 用户可以对包厢及消费进行评价。
2. 商家需求
(1) 商家可以添加、编辑、删除包厢信息。
(2) 商家可以查看包厢预订情况,以及历史预订记录。
(3) 商家可以进行消费记录查询、修改、删除。
(4) 商家可以生成对账单。
三、系统设计
1.技术选型
(1) 前端:HTML、CSS、JavaScript、Vue.js
(2) 后端:Java、Spring Boot、MyBatis、MySQL
2. 系统架构设计
(1) 系统采用前后端分离架构。
(2) 前端使用Vue.js,实现用户界面;后端使用MyBatis实现数据交互,通过接口调用MySQL数据库存储数据。
(3) 系统采用Restful API设计,实现多终端访问。
3. 数据库设计
(1) 用户表:包括用户ID、用户名、密码、电话、邮箱等。
(2) 包厢表:包括包厢ID、包厢名称、包厢类型、价格等。
(3) 消费表:包括消费ID、消费明细、消费时间、消费金额等。
(4) 商家表:包括商家ID、商家名称、联系方式等。
(5) 对账单表:包括对账单ID、对账单时间、对账单内容等。
四、系统实现
1.前端开发
(1) 使用Vue-cli创建项目,安装依赖。
(2) 使用Vue的单文件组件实现用户界面。
(3) 使用Vue的axios库调用后端接口,获取数据并展示。
(4) 使用Vue的life-event组件实现用户交互功能,如搜索、排序等。
2. 后端开发
(1) 使用MyBatis实现数据层的搭建。
(2) 使用Spring Boot实现业务逻辑的实现。
(3) 使用MySQL存储数据,并设计合理的索引。
(4) 对接 payment 支付接口,实现支付功能。
3. 系统部署与测试
(1) 使用Docker部署系统,发布到服务器。
(2) 使用Postman等工具进行测试,确保系统功能正常。 五、系统维护
1.升级系统:根据实际需求,对系统进行升级,增强系统功能。
2. 数据备份:定期对系统数据进行备份,防止数据丢失。
3. 安全性维护:对用户密码等敏感信息进行加密处理,提高系统安全性。
4. 性能优化:对系统性能进行优化,提高系统运行速度。
本文 智隆范文模板网 原创,转载保留链接!网址:https://www.77788854.com/lXj8uGCsrSJe.html
声明
1.本站所有内容除非特别标注,否则均为本站原创,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任。2.本站内容仅做参考,用户应自行判断内容之真实性。切勿撰写粗言秽语、毁谤、渲染色情暴力或人身攻击的言论,敬请自律。